On This Day

10 events
2019
A sightseeing helicopter crashed in the mountains of Skoddevarre in Alta, Norway, killing all six people on board.
2010
The last episode of The Bill, the longest-running police drama in British television history, was broadcast.
2002
Typhoon Rusa made landfall in Goheung as the most powerful typhoon to hit South Korea in 43 years, killing at least 236 people.
1997
Diana, Princess of Wales (pictured), her partner Dodi Fayed, and their driver were killed in a car crash in Paris.
1969
On the final day of the Isle of Wight Festival 1969, attended by approximately 150,000 people over three days, Bob Dylan appeared in his first gig in three years.
1959
A parcel bomb sent by Ngô Đình Nhu (pictured), younger brother and chief adviser of South Vietnamese president Ngô Đình Diệm, failed to kill Norodom Sihanouk, Prime Minister of Cambodia.
1942
The Matagorda hurricane, the most intense and costliest tropical cyclone of the 1942 Atlantic hurricane season, dissipated after causing $26.5 million in damages and eight deaths.
1941
World War II: A detachment of Chetniks captured the town of Loznica in German-occupied Serbia.
1940
Second World War: Two Royal navy destroyers were lost to mines and two other vessels damaged off Texel, Netherlands, killing around 300 men.
1939
Nazi forces, posing as Poles, staged an attack against the German radio station Sender Gleiwitz in Gleiwitz, Upper Silesia, Germany, creating an excuse to invade Poland the next day.
